In case anyone was wondering, this is how credit is deducted from your Oyster card on the Emirates Airline (attached).
So it would appear the entry barriers deduct £3.20 immediately and the exit barrier deduct £0.00. This was also confirmed by the balance shown on the gate: £0.00 on the entry touch.
This leads me to assume that's why you can't do a return on Oyster without touching out. Because you'll only be charged £3.20.
These deductions also don't show up on the online journey history.
